草庐IT

php json可读格式

全部标签

java - 如何在 Java 调试详细信息格式化程序中将字节数组显示为字符串?

我想编写一个简单的详细格式化程序来显示byte[]数据形式为String(使用String.([B)做肮脏的工作)。但是,我不确定如何找到[B的类名创建格式化程序时使用。这可能吗?或者,是否有另一种方法可以在调试器中将字节数组视为字符串? 最佳答案 我不知道如何让eclipse的详细格式化程序自动将字节数组显示为字符串,但您可以通过添加newString(byteArray)作为监视表达式来显示特定的字节数组。 关于java-如何在Java调试详细信息格式化程序中将字节数组显示为字符串?

java - 在 Scala 中格式化字符串的最佳方式是什么?

我想知道在Scala中格式化字符串的最佳方式是什么。我正在为一个类重新实现toString方法,它是一个相当长且复杂的字符串。我考虑过使用String.format但它似乎与Scala有问题。是否有用于执行此操作的nativeScala函数? 最佳答案 我只是用错了。正确的用法是.format(parem1,parem2)。 关于java-在Scala中格式化字符串的最佳方式是什么?,我们在StackOverflow上找到一个类似的问题: https://st

java - 如何将字节数组转换为人类可读的格式?

我正在使用“Blowfish”算法对文本内容进行加密和解密。我在图像中嵌入了加密内容,但在提取时我得到了字节数组,我将其传递给Cipher类的方法update。但是该方法返回字节数组,我想将其转换回人类可读的形式。当我使用FileOutputStream的write方法时,在提供文件名时它工作正常。但现在我想以人类可读的格式在控制台上打印它。如何度过难关?我也尝试过ByteArrayOutputStream。但效果不佳。谢谢。 最佳答案 如果您只想查看数值,您可以遍历数组并打印每个字节:for(bytefoo:arr){System

java - 将 Unix 时间转换为 Java 中可读的日期

在Java中最简单的方法是什么?理想情况下,我将使用以毫秒为单位的Unix时间作为输入,该函数将输出类似的字符串2011年11月7日下午5:00 最佳答案 SimpleDateFormatsdf=newSimpleDateFormat("MMMMd,yyyy'at'h:mma");Stringdate=sdf.format(myTimestamp); 关于java-将Unix时间转换为Java中可读的日期,我们在StackOverflow上找到一个类似的问题:

C#在“处理”按钮事件时如何更改按钮图标/格式化?

我有几个服务器HtmlButton在这样的代码中创建的S:HtmlButtonbutton=newHtmlButton();button.ID=idString+"_btnStart";button.InnerHtml="";button.Attributes.Add("type","button");button.Attributes.Add("runat","server");button.Attributes.Add("class","btnbtn-linkbtn-xs");button.Attributes.Add("title","Start");button.ServerClick

java - 将java中的指数值转换为数字格式

我正在尝试使用java从excel表中读取值。当我在Excel的单元格中键入超过10个字母时,它以指数形式显示,如“9.78313E+2”。但这不是我给出的真实数字。任何人都可以帮助我解决这个问题。如何使用java语言将上述指数形式转换为原始数字。提前致谢 最佳答案 可以如下转换,例如:newBigDecimal("406770000244E+12").toBigInteger(); 关于java-将java中的指数值转换为数字格式,我们在StackOverflow上找到一个类似的问题:

用Pandoc生成TXT格式的目录

我一直使用Markdown格式写作,使用Pandoc生成PDF和Word格式的文档。Pandoc能生成很好的章节和目录,但有时候,也需要生成TXT格式的目录,今天就尝试了一下。由于我写的内容章节比较多,所以我先写了一个Makefile,主要内容如下:PANDOC=pandocNAME=大道至简VER=0SRC=meta.md\ 1.md\ 2.md\ 3.md\ 4.md\ 5.md\ 5-2.md\ 5-x.mdtxt: $(PANDOC)-s--toc--variabledocumentclass="report"\ --number-sections\ --mathjax\ --lua-

java - 从 ArrayList 创建格式化字符串

考虑以下代码:ArrayListaList=newArrayList();aList.add(2134);aList.add(3423);aList.add(4234);aList.add(343);StringtmpString="(";for(intaValue:aList){tmpString+=aValue+",";}tmpString=(String)tmpString.subSequence(0,tmpString.length()-1)+")";System.out.println(tmpString);我这里的结果是预期的(2134,3423,4234,343)..我确

java - 在java中格式化本地时间

我正在创建我的JavaFX应用程序,每次创建新的列表单元格时我都需要使用时间标签。我需要将当前时间的字符串以HH:MM格式直接放入以String作为参数的Label构造函数中。我发现并使用了java.util.Date的:LabeltimeLabel=newLabel(newSimpleDateFormat("HH:MM").format(newDate()));但是它显示了错误的时区,所以我打算使用java.time和LocalTime类。有没有办法在一行中实现相同的字符串结果?谢谢你的帮助:) 最佳答案 在新应用程序中使用Jav

java - 如何在 Scala 中以字符串格式重复参数

如何重复使用相同的字符串进行格式放置?例如"%s-%s-%s"format("OK")>>"OK-OK-OK" 最佳答案 这应该有效:"%1$s-%1$s-%1$s"format"OK"WrappedString的格式方法在后台使用java.util.Formatter。还有FormatterJavadoc说:Theformatspecifiersforgeneral,character,andnumerictypeshavethefollowingsyntax:%[argument_index$][flags][width][.p